This week, it wasn’t just Wolfsburg’s poor results that had critics scenting blood, but German tabloid Bild’s leaking of Magath’s extraordinary fine system implemented this season. Some rules were standard old-school discipline (€100 docked for every minute of a player’s lateness to training, €250 for wearing headphones on the team bus) but others were simply beyond the pale; it would cost a defender €500 if he let the ball bounce in front of him before clearing, and €1000 would be deducted from a player for every “unnecessary” backpass. In addition to this, Mandzukic and Patrick Helmes were both reportedly hit with whopping €10,000 penalties for failing to follow tactical instructions in the defeat at Freiburg.
